About the Role:

As our Space Planning Analyst, you will play a crucial role in shaping the in-store experience across all our locations. You’ll be at the forefront of developing and implementing seasonal visual merchandising guidelines, ensuring that each store is optimized for maximum impact. You will collaborate closely with Retail, B&M, and our Senior Visual Merchandising & Concept Manager to bring new projects and store concepts to life.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Plan and organize retail spaces to maximize sales each season, aligning with store segmentations.
  • Work closely with merchandising and store teams to create effective store layouts based on seasonal visual merchandising (VM) guidance.
  • Maintain and update store space counts to ensure relevance and accuracy.
  • Analyse sales data and monitor market trends to inform store layout decisions.
  • Compile and distribute seasonal VM guidance to stores.
  • Conduct regular store visits to ensure that layouts are effective and identify opportunities for improvement.
  • Collaborate with brands to ensure new fixtures and fittings are correctly integrated into store spaces.
  • Attend key events such as conferences, roadshows, and seasonal briefs across the country.

Skills & Qualifications:

  • Previous experience in visual merchandising and space planning.
  • Strong project management, influencing, and negotiation skills.
  • Excellent communication and presentation abilities.
  • Proficiency in Adobe,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.
  • Strong time management, organizational skills, and multi-tasking ability.
  • A meticulous attention to detail and a self-starting attitude.
